Specification | Samsung Galaxy J1 Ace | LG Optimus L7 II Dual P715 |
---|---|---|
RAM | 512 MB | 768 MB |
CPU | 1.3 GHz, Dual Core Processor | 1 GHz, Dual Core Processor |
Battery | 1800 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 2460 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
Rear Camera | 5 MP | 8 MP with autofocus |
OS | Android v4.4 (KitKat) | Android v4.1.2 (Jelly Bean) |
Price | ₹4,549 | ₹4,250 |
